Plaintiff Manuel de Jesus Rosario having filed a motion pursuant to Rules 64 and 65 of the
Federal Rules of Civil Procedure seeking an attachment against the real property located at 251 E.
123 rd St., New York, NY 10035 (Block: 01788; Lot: 0022) (the "Building") and a preliminary
injunction restraining defendants from transferring or encumbering th~ Building, the defendants
having filed no opposition to Plaintiffs motion, and this Court having found that Plaintiff has met
the criteria for an attachment and preliminary injunction, for the reasoµs set forth in the Court's
Order dated March 5, 2020;
NOW, on motion of Ross & Asmar LLC, attorneys for Plaintiff/' it is:
ORDERED that Plaintiffs motion for an attachment is granted in its entirety, and that the
amount to be secured by this Order of Attachment shall be $89,670.35; comprised of the amount
of judgment sought, plus fees and expenses of the United States Marshal; and it is further
ORDERED that the United States Marshal for the Southern District of New York or any
person appointed to act in his place and stead, or Plaintiff's attorneys, levy upon, but refrain from
taking into actual custody pending further order of this Court, the Building; and it is further
ORDERED that defendants, their agents, subdivisions, servants, employees, successors,
I
and attorneys are hereby ENJOINED AND RESTRAINED until further Order of this Court from
directly or indirectly transferring or encumbering the Building; and it is further
l
'
ORDERED that this Order of Attachment may be served by the United States Marshal or
any person appointed to act in his place and stead, or by the attorneys for Plaintiff.
